Heat shrink fabric refers to thermoplastic tubing that contracts radially upon heating, creating a tight protective covering for cables and wires. This material is engineered to provide insulation, mechanical protection, and environmental sealing in modern electronic, industrial, and aerospace applications. Its importance lies in enhancing system reliability through strain relief, moisture resistance, and dielectric insulation.
| Type | Functional Features | Application Examples |
|---|---|---|
| Standard Polyolefin | General-purpose insulation, 2:1 shrink ratio, UV resistance | Consumer electronics wiring |
| Double-Wall Adhesive | Internal adhesive layer for sealing, 3:1 shrink ratio | Military connectors |
| PVC Heat Shrink | Flexible, flame-retardant, cost-effective | Automotive harnesses |
| PTFE/FEP Tubing | High-temperature resistance (200 C+), chemical inertness | Aerospace sensor cables |
| Expandable Braided Sleeving | Recoverable diameter adjustment, abrasion resistance | Industrial robotics |
Typical construction includes: - Base Material: Cross-linked polyolefin, PVC, or fluoropolymers - Adhesive Layer: Thermoplastic elastomer (for sealing variants) - Additives: UV stabilizers, flame retardants, colorants - Wall Structure: Single-wall (basic protection) or double-wall (with adhesive lining)
| Parameter | Typical Range | Importance |
|---|---|---|
| Shrink Temperature | 85-200 C | Determines application compatibility |
| Shrink Ratio | 2:1 to 6:1 | Affects size flexibility |
| Dielectric Strength | 15-50 kV/mm | Ensures electrical safety |
| Operating Temperature | -55 C to +150 C | Defines environmental limits |
| Adhesion Strength | 0.5-4.0 N/mm | Sealing performance indicator |
